Also add the '#nullable enable' directive the compiler requires to the generated Indicators.g.cs, clearing the four CS8669 warnings on the nullable double[] profile return types. * fix(java): marshal C ABI bool params correctly; add 514 golden replay The Java FFM binding marshalled the cross-section state flags (newHigh, newLow, aboveMa, onBuySignal) as JAVA_DOUBLE arrays, but the C ABI takes them as const bool* (one byte each), so the native side read the low byte of each 8-byte double and saw every flag as false. Add WickraNative. boolSegment and use it across the 15 cross-section indicators. Also pass the MacdExt MaType arguments as byte to match the uint8_t downcall descriptor (was int, throwing WrongMethodTypeException). Add GoldenAllTest.java (generated by gen_golden_test.py): a reflection runner replaying all 514 indicators against the Rust reference fixtures. The bugs above were found by this test; 514/514 now pass. * fix(r): marshal C ABI bool flags correctly; add 514 golden replay The R wrapper passed the cross-section state flags as (bool *)REAL(x), reinterpreting the 8-byte doubles as 1-byte bools so the native side read every flag as false. Add wk_bool_vec to convert each flag vector into a real C bool buffer and use it for all 15 cross-section update wrappers.
